Which side of the plane to sit from Ramón Villeda Morales International Airport (San Pedro Sula) to John F Kennedy International Airport (New York)?
Right Side of the Plane
The right side offers superior views of the Caribbean islands, the lush landscapes of western Cuba, and the iconic coastline of the United States from Florida to the Outer Banks.
Bay Islands
Stunning views of the turquoise waters and coral reefs surrounding Roatán and Utila shortly after departure.
Western Cuba
Overhead views of the Pinar del Río province, known for its limestone mogotes and tobacco fields.
Florida Keys
A chain of islands stretching into the Gulf, visible as the flight transitions to the U.S. mainland.
Miami Beach
A clear view of the high-rise hotels along the Atlantic coast and the busy Port of Miami.
Outer Banks
The unique thin strip of barrier islands off the coast of North Carolina, including Cape Hatteras.
Jersey Shore
The final stretch before arrival, featuring the boardwalks and beaches of the New Jersey coastline.
The right side is the 'ocean view' side. Sit here to witness the dramatic transition from the tropical Caribbean colors to the deep Atlantic blue. On arrival, this side typically offers the best view of the Long Island shoreline and the Atlantic Ocean during the final approach into JFK.
Ulúa River Valley
Aerial views of the winding river and the Sula Valley shortly after takeoff from San Pedro Sula.
Gulf of Mexico
A vast expanse of deep blue water as the flight crosses from the Caribbean toward the U.S. coast.
Tampa Bay
Distant views of the Florida Gulf Coast and the urban sprawl around the Tampa and Clearwater areas.
Mid-Atlantic Coastline
Strategic views of the Delmarva Peninsula and the Chesapeake Bay bridge-tunnels during descent.
Manhattan Skyline
On specific northerly approaches into JFK, a distant view of the skyscrapers and Central Park is possible.
Choose the left side for morning flights to keep the sun behind you. This side is ideal for spotting the silhouette of the Appalachian Mountains in the far distance on exceptionally clear days and provides better views of the D.C. area from high altitude.
